Ignition process of oil and gas dual burner

If gas is selected, the gas leakage detection device works to detect whether the gas pressure is normal and whether there is gas leakage. If it is normal (if the fuel is diesel, this detection process is not available), then the next step is to switch to the combustion controller. Before the ignition of a stove or furnace purging 36 seconds, if after the purge air pressure switch check enough pressure, servo motor to the ignition position - CAM Ⅴ set position, the ignition transformer energizing, spark ignition electrode, and a double solenoid valve is opened entirely (if the fuel is diesel, the level of electromagnetic valve and solenoid valve open), fuel mixing head, mixed with the air fan sent, ignition burning.

 

After 2-3 seconds, the ignition transformer stops working, and the photoelectric eye detects the flame signal. If the flame signal is normal, the controller will supply power to the servo motor, turn to the setting position of Cam II, and work with low fire. If the selector switch to allow the fire, and two temperature controller allows, the servo motor to continue running (if the fuel is diesel, the transfer to the CAM Ⅰ Settings are opened at the location of the secondary electromagnetic valve,) to the CAM Ⅱ II set position, the fire work.

 

If fuel is selected, allow the knob to close at full load and start the burner. By adjusting the throttle lever, after make the burner ignition, damper at about 10%, the status of flame and gas color, if gas is white smoke, the damper is larger, the appropriate measures to reduce CAM, if gas is black smoke, the small air door, need to appropriately increase the CAM (2), until the burner flame bright, exhaust almost no color.

 

Turn the full load permit knob on, start the burner, and wait until the burner is turned to the fire. Adjust the air door adjusting steel belt, so that the size of the air door opening should be about 70-80%. Then observe the exhaust gas and flame state, if the exhaust gas is white smoke, the damper is larger, it is necessary to appropriately reduce the CAM, or reduce the position of the steel belt, if the exhaust gas is black smoke, the damper is smaller, it is necessary to appropriately increase the CAM, or increase the position of the steel belt. Until the burner flame is bright and the exhaust gas is basically colorless.
